In NBA 2K14, players are unable to break the backboard during gameplay. While some previous basketball games featured this mechanic, NBA 2K14 does not include it. Players can perform a variety of dunks and highlight plays, but shattering the backboard is not one of them. The focus remains on realistic gameplay and player performance rather than dramatic visual effects.

In NBA 2K14, once you delete a My Player character, it cannot be restored. The deletion is permanent, and the game does not have a built-in feature to recover deleted players. It's important to be cautious when managing your My Player files to avoid accidental deletions. Always consider backing up your save data if possible.
